What is a HC?
-
HEAVY COMBINATION (HC): A truck (including a prime mover or mobile crane) over 8t GVM with a trailer of more than 9t GVM.
-
Also includes trucks and buses in HR licence categories.
Prerequisites
-
To upgrade to this HC class of licence you must have held a Medium Rigid (MR) or Heavy Rigid (HR) licence for at least 12 months (1 year).
-
Complete a QLD licence application form (we can supply).
-
Become competent with the vehicle (4-10 hours average/competency based).
-
Pass a practical driving test at QLD Transport usually using our vehicle.
